About the Role
The Laboratory Quality Manager oversees the Quality Management System (QMS) in the laboratory, developing and implementing quality control processes, ensuring compliance with regulatory standards, conducting audits, managing documentation, compiling reports, and fostering a culture of continuous improvement to uphold high standards in testing and analysis.
Responsibilities
- Ensure compliance with laboratory accreditations, regulatory standards, and information management policies by providing leadership and guidance.
- Provide guidance and consultation concerning laboratory quality processes.
- Ensure that quality policies, processes, and procedures are established, current, and adhered to by all laboratory staff.
- Identify and report quality issues and problems to management with recommendations for resolution, including any training needs.
- Oversee internal audit processes, external assessments, proficiency testing programs, document control systems, competency assessment, training, and other quality processes.
- Analyze data, develop reports, identify trends, monitor prevention and correction of quality deviations.
- Manage data collection, analysis, and reporting of point-of-care test results.
- Implement and maintain quality control procedures; ensure accuracy and reliability of point-of-care test results.
- Ensure training and competencies are completed and up-to-date by all testing personnel.
- Establish processes and policies for effective and professional communication between laboratory staff and among other departments within the hospital.
- Monitor customer satisfaction and performance metrics.
- Recommend best practices to maintain and improve project outcomes and laboratory functions.
- Assist in purchasing of laboratory equipment and managing inventory of supplies.
- Participate in various hospital committees.
- Document minutes for all laboratory meetings.
- Perform other duties as assigned.
Requirements
- Bachelor’s degree in medical laboratory science or related field.
- 4 years of laboratory experience preferred.
- National certification: MLS(ASCP) or equivalent required.
- Louisiana State license as a Clinical Laboratory Scientist required.
- Ability to read, analyze, and interpret common specific and technical journals, financial reports, and legal documents.
- Knowledge of lab quality assurance and regulatory compliance.
- Strong leadership, communication, organizational, and problem-solving skills.
